The ancient Iranian religion Zoroastrianism was important because _____.

Zoroastrianism was the religion of the ancient Persian empire. Many people at the time believed in this religion. However, it was important because it has influenced and influenced the other religions that are considered to be major ones today, these include christianity and islam.
